Getting started with a Raspberry Pi can open up endless possibilities—from building a home server to retro gaming setups or smart automation. But diving in without preparation often leads to simple mistakes that can compromise your project or damage your hardware. Here are the most common errors and how to avoid them.
Start with basic projects
If you’re new to Raspberry Pi or Linux, begin with small, manageable tasks that match your experience. This approach helps you gradually understand the operating system, hardware behavior, and connectivity without being overwhelmed.
Use a dedicated SD card
Never swap your Raspberry Pi’s SD card between different devices. Doing so can lead to faster wear and increased risk of data corruption. Stick to known brands like Samsung or Lexar and regularly back up your projects.
Configure HDMI settings properly
Unlike Windows, many Raspberry Pi systems require manual HDMI configuration. If your monitor doesn’t display the image, edit the boot/config.txt file and add hdmi_force_hotplug=1 to ensure proper resolution detection.
Don’t overload USB ports
The USB ports on a Raspberry Pi offer limited power. Plugging in multiple drives without external power can lead to system instability. Use powered hubs or external adapters if you’re building a NAS or similar system.
Manage heat effectively
When using your Raspberry Pi for streaming or server tasks, ensure you use a heatsink or fan to keep temperatures down. Overheating reduces performance and may permanently damage the board. Also, keep enclosures well-ventilated.
By keeping these key points in mind, you’ll ensure a smoother and more reliable Raspberry Pi experience while extending the life of your device.
